Police Blotter: Thirsty Thieves Take 20 Bottles of Vodka

The following incidents were reported by Ladue Police for the week ending March 25.

March 19

12:42 p.m. A resident in the 10000 block of Conway Road reported a case of fraud involving her debit card.

2:20 p.m. Police responded to a report of a dog bite on Fielding Road. The victim suffered minor injuries.

March 20

5:27 p.m. Police responded to the scene of a two-vehicle accident on southbound I-170 at Laude Road. The driver of one of the vehicles was arrested for assaulting a tow truck driver.

8:01 p.m. Police were informed of the theft of around 20 bottles of vodka at 7 p.m. The incident occurred in the 8000 block of Ladue Road.  

March 23

1:05 p.m. A junior high student reported that their cell phone was stolen from their binder while at a school in the 9700 block of Conway Rd. 

10:01 p.m. Police received a 911 call from a residence on Babler Lane. When they arrived, they determined a 23-year-old had assaulted his mother. The son was transported to an area hospital for an evaluation. 

March 24

1:47 p.m. Police responded to a minor two-vehicle accident on westbound I-64 at McKnight Rd.
